Japan's largest electric utility, serving the greater Tokyo region and still managing the long-term decommissioning of the Fukushima Daiichi nuclear plant, which reported a full-year net loss of ¥454.3 billion for the year ended March 31, 2026, reversing ¥161.3 billion in net income a year earlier as sales fell to ¥5.74 trillion. TEPCO booked a further operating loss of ¥34.3 billion in the June 2026 quarter on higher fuel and wholesale electricity costs, and declined to issue full-year guidance for the year to March 2027 citing fuel-price and wholesale-market volatility tied to Middle East conditions, keeping its dividend forecast at zero.
